Simultaneous patenting and pickling of hot rolled steel - in molten caustic soda contg. sodium hydride

摘要
Hot-rolled steel wire rod, intended for drawing operations, after leaving the rolls at 1000-1050 degrees C. is intermittently water-cooled on its surface to 650-700 degrees C. in steps sepd. by stages permitting heat to travel from the core to the surface so a rod temp. of 650-750 degrees C. is reached and the rod, at just below the Ac3 temp., is continuously cooled in molten salt at 350-500 degrees C., the salt having reducing properties; the individual loops of rod are exposed to intensive circulation of the salt for the simultaneous achievement of the optimum structural transformation for drawing with surface pickling, and the coils are then washed to remove salt and for cooling to ambient temp. Continuous process eliminates a separate pickling operation, thus reducing costs.
